ABOUT THE ORGANIZATION Support Experience Engineering builds the technology that powers Stripe's global support operations. Our engineers create the systems and services that support agents worldwide rely on every day to resolve issues for Stripe's millions of merchants and users — at scale, in real time, and across a growing range of channels and offerings. The Case Resolution Platform team owns the core infrastructure and tooling that enables support agents around the world to do their best work. This includes case routing, live channels infrastructure spanning voice and messaging, machine translation, and integrations that connect Stripe's support stack to the platforms agents depend on. WHAT YOU'LL DO We're looking for full-stack engineers who want to make an impact on the tools and infrastructure that power global customer support at scale. Our team collaborates with many cross-functional teams — from Infrastructure to Product to Operations — to deliver reliable, high-quality systems that support agents and merchants depend on every day. The team is actively expanding its live channels infrastructure to support new messaging platforms, including in Greater China, requiring collaboration with third-party providers in the region. ABOUT THE TEAM The Premium Merchant Experiences team helps businesses using Stripe succeed by providing high-quality, contextual, and timely premium support options. Our Dublin-based team is a startup within Stripe, building a greenfield product – offering both automated, AI-driven support and improved access to technical experts across Stripe. In addition to building directly for Stripe's merchants, we are responsible for building robust internal tooling that empowers Stripe employees in support roles to deliver the best possible experience for our customers.
